#CA8DEE Hex Color Code

#CA8DEE

The Hexadecimal Color #CA8DEE is a contrast shade of Plum. #CA8DEE RGB value is rgb(202, 141, 238). RGB Color Model of #CA8DEE consists of 79% red, 55% green and 93% blue. HSL color Mode of #CA8DEE has 278°(degrees) Hue, 74% Saturation and 74% Lightness. #CA8DEE color has an wavelength of 444.96296n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CA8DEE is #CC99F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CA8DEE is #C8E. The Closest Color to #CA8DEE is #DDA0DD. Official Name of #CA8DEE Hex Code is Light Wisteria.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CA8DEE is 15 Cyan 41 Magenta 0 Yellow 7 Black and #CA8DEE CMY is 15, 41,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CA8DEE is hsl(278,74,74,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(278, 41, 93).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CA8DEE is 49.31, 37.78, 85.57.
Hex8 Value of #CA8DEE is #CA8DEEFF. Decimal Value of #CA8DEE is 13274606 and Octal Value of #CA8DEE is 62506756. Binary Value of #CA8DEE is 11001010, 10001101, 11101110 and Android of #CA8DEE is 4291464686 / 0xffca8dee.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CA8DEE is 0.286, 0.219, 0.219 and YIQ Color Space of #CA8DEE is 170.297, 5.1838, 43.0879.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CA8DEE is 38.47, 29.96, 84.81.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CA8DEE is 67.86, 40.3, -39.98.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CA8DEE is 67.86, 24.85, -69.46.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CA8DEE is 67.86, 56.77, 315.23. Hunter Lab variable of #CA8DEE is 61.47, 35.64, -39.52.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CA8DEE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
